Imagine there's only one thing you want: The announcement of the next GTA. And then finally, after years of waiting, they announce it! And then say nothing for a full year, minus a handful of screenshots.

 

2011 - October: Announcement

2011 - November: Trailer 8 days later.

2011 - December: Nothing

2012 - January: Nothing

2012 - February: Nothing

2012 - March: Nothing

2012 - April: Nothing

2012 - May: Nothing

2012 - June: Nothing

2012 - July: 2 screenshots

2012 - August: 10 total screenshots, Transport, Leisure & Business

2012 - September: Nothing

2012 - October: GTA V announced for Game Informer's December cover, New Artwork: Pest Control, GTA V announced for Spring 2013 release

2012 - November: Hurricane Sandy delays second Trailer, Game Informer's Cover Story released and previews across other sites, Trailer 2 released

2012 - December: Nothing

2013 - January: Box Art reveal later this month, 31st January, No box art revealed. Game delayed to September 17th 2013.

 

At that point it was small stuff until the marketing cycle began in around April 2013.

I specially remember the August 2012 screenshots (first half of 2012 was almost completely dedicated to Max Payne 3 marketing-wise, and I remember people theorizing very angry they had only teased GTAV at that moment in order to attract people to their Newswire and help the marketing campaign of MP3, which it might actually had been the case). After the heli and Mirror Park screenshots, they unexpectedly celebrated the "Business. Leisure. Transport" screenshots week. I remember each of those articles in their Newswire had +30,000 comments, which it's a lot by the standards of any blog, specially those days. And the Friday the only thing they said was: "we will have more to show you in a few weeks or so". And then that turned into almost an omnipresent meme within the community at that time. Someone even made a song on that phrase! Anybody remember? 

And then the January 2013 events: they had promised that they'd reveal the cover that month, so in the last day everyone was waiting for it, but not only they didn't reveal the cover on the 31st, but they used that day to announce the nearly 4-months delay of the game itself. 

But at least the rest of the campaign was truly enojable, specially the "Sunsets, Seas, Skies and So On" set of screens and the week of the Gameplay Trailer.
